Career
He was signed by the New York Giants as an undrafted free agent in 2007. He played college football at Western Illinois. In 43 games, he caught 109 passes for 1,691 yards and 11 touchdowns
NFL
Thomas began his NFL career as an undrafted free agent for the New York Giants.
He also spent time with the New York Jets from 2007-2008 and both the Oakland Raiders and San Diego Chargers in 2008.
Arena Football League
Thomas began his Arena Football League career with the Chicago Rush in 2010. Chicago picked up Thomas at the end of the season.
He caught 25 passes for 323 yards and two touchdowns before a knee injury ended his season. In 2011, he returned to the Rush and caught 16 passes for 140 yards and one touchdown before being released.
After his release, he joined the San Jose SaberCats.
